The Value of IEEE Publications
| Year after year, the value of IEEE content
continues to climb. IEEE is the most-cited
publisher in new technology patents, and
according to the Thomson ISI
Journal Citation Report, IEEE publishes 18 of
the top 20 journals in Electrical and Electronics
Engineering, along with the top journals in many other
fields of technology.
